如何使用apt-get在特定目录中安装任何软件包?

我想知道是否有办法让apt-get在除了/usr/bin之外的目录中安装软件包。 比如说,我希望apt-get从现在开始将所有的软件包安装到/software目录下。有没有任何可能性实现这个要求?我希望有类似于编译源代码时使用的--prefix选项的功能。
谢谢。
1个回答

你可以使用dpkg代替apt-get来得到更多的选项。 其中一个选项是指定安装目录。你可以执行sudo dpkg -i file.deb --instdir=destdir,其中destdir是你想要的安装目录。

无法帮助 :(. dpkg: 处理 --instdir=/usr/xx (--install) 时出错: 无法访问存档文件: 没有此文件或目录 $ ls -l /usr/xx/ 总用量 0 - piro
文件夹 /usr/xx 存在吗? - Tiago Carrondo